Output e0625ac30ed5fc8a13f91ae50831d6ae25f6a01d95aab8129b54c08be117a12f:0

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 532ec6ae7cc2c47eb985741b7161bc253f3856d7f4974ad93c8080d4db1ed4c2
address
tb1p2vhvdtnuctz8awv9wsdhzcduy5lns4kh7jt54kfuszqdfkc76npqv34dhp
transaction
e0625ac30ed5fc8a13f91ae50831d6ae25f6a01d95aab8129b54c08be117a12f
spent
true